Transaction 95e36d31c1102a58448ae97efaaab911b76da190231e379f15d6305d2e26679e

1 Input
2 Outputs
  • 95e36d31c1102a58448ae97efaaab911b76da190231e379f15d6305d2e26679e:0
  • value  1000000
    address  1K2bQGLG8HSPjsasfGTGjdf51gCtB69yDV
  • 95e36d31c1102a58448ae97efaaab911b76da190231e379f15d6305d2e26679e:1
  • value  54207336
    address  bc1qnyjrrmuj4v48dudx0rjvkmlwltwr44e3fhtnkr